PROBLEM TO BE SOLVED: To provide a front part structure of an automobile body to increase the collision energy absorption by optimizing the crush deformation of the front part structure of the automobile body in a head-on collision of the automobile. SOLUTION: The load in the head-on collision can be surely supported by setting a high rigid area S4 at a rear end part of a front part part of an automobile, the crush axial forces of a front part low rigid area S1 and a rear low rigid area S3 are supported by a front part high rigid area S2 and the rear high rigid area S4 at each rear side to excellently achieve the crush deformation of the low rigid areas S1 and S3 in the longitudinal direction, and the rise of the crush reaction in the initial stage of the collision is increased as a whole by the presence of the front part high rigid area S2, and the collision energy absorption can be increased.
